If you’re growing rare plants that require high humidity, investing in a humidity cabinet can make all the difference. These cabinets provide a controlled environment, helping your plants thrive where outdoor conditions might fall short. However, while a humidity cabinet offers many benefits, it also introduces a hidden risk: mold growth. If you’re not careful, excessive moisture can lead to mold, which can quickly become a serious problem.
One of the main causes of mold in humidity cabinets is poor airflow combined with high humidity levels. To minimize this risk, you should guarantee proper ventilation and monitor moisture levels regularly. Incorporating a drip irrigation system can help regulate water delivery, preventing overwatering that creates damp conditions conducive to mold. Drip irrigation allows you to water your plants slowly and consistently, reducing excess moisture and keeping the environment balanced. It also makes pest management easier, as you can target watering precisely without splashing water onto leaves or soil surface, which can attract pests or promote mold growth. Another aspect to focus on is pest management. Excess humidity often attracts pests like mold mites or fungal gnats, which thrive in damp environments. Regular inspection of your plants and environment is vital. Using integrated pest management techniques, such as removing decaying plant material and maintaining cleanliness, can help prevent infestations. Additionally, ensuring good airflow reduces the chances of pests settling into your setup. When combined with proper humidity control, these practices keep your rare plants healthier and less vulnerable to mold and pest issues. Regular cleaning of the cabinet with gentle disinfectants, especially in corners and crevices, can also reduce the presence of mold spores that might otherwise settle unnoticed.

Can Mold Spores Spread to Other Plants Nearby?
Yes, mold spores can spread to other plants nearby through mold spore transfer, increasing cross contamination risks. When mold spores become airborne, they can settle on nearby plants, especially in humid environments. To minimize this, guarantee proper airflow, regularly clean your cabinets, and isolate infected plants. Keeping your plants and equipment clean reduces the chance of mold spreading and helps protect your entire collection from mold-related issues.
